Cannot go wrong no matter what lake you choose. If you want to sight fish clear lakes such as Dixon, Poway, are good choices they are small lakes and the boats you rent are affordable and have a trolling motor not a gas. If you want to just cast and fish not really looking for sight fish there is. Sutherland, Hodges, El cap, etc. Sutherland has great shore fishing and you can move around and park in front of your spot. The whole south shore from the boat dock to dam. Fly lining crawlers, shiners, dads all work great. For lures jerk baits like the diawa td minnow, carolina rigged worms such as reepers are an excellent choice. Not so much a spinner bait slash crank bait lake.

yup ticketmaster only.. most unpressured lake in Cali i would say. It's open 3 days a week and only from May - Sept. Maximum of 100 anglers on this lake per day...
